What is Security Stack Exchange?
Security Stack Exchange, often abbreviated as “SecSE,” is part of the Stack Exchange network, which hosts a variety of question-and-answer communities on diverse topics. SecSE, in particular, focuses on cybersecurity, information security, and related fields. It provides a platform where individuals can pose questions, seek advice, and share their knowledge about all things cybersecurity.

How to Get Started with Security Stack Exchange
Getting started with Security Stack Exchange is simple:
- Create an Account: Sign up for a free account on the Stack Exchange network if you don’t already have one.
- Explore and Search: Use the search bar to find answers to your existing questions or explore existing discussions.
- Ask Questions: If you can’t find an answer to your question, ask it. Be sure to provide context and details to receive the most accurate responses.
- Participate: Engage with the community by answering questions, upvoting helpful answers, and contributing to discussions.
- Follow Tags: Subscribe to relevant tags to stay updated on topics of interest.
- Respect Guidelines: Follow the community guidelines and be respectful and professional in your interactions.
